  3. At least one way is online at the www.syncmyride.com web site. For me, clicking the tab "Account Settings" shows the following report: SYNC Version Gen2 - V3.5.1DA5T-14D546-BB DA5T-14D546-DB DA5T-14F496-AH DA5T-14F497-AJ DA5T-14F657-AK My car was built on 3/13, and also has the A4 version of maps. No problems so far.

  13. Yes, I believe the sensors use ultrasound, which detects an obstruction of any type, good if you're worried about kids or pets (or a lady) being in back! The SEL with 302A package also comes with a rear vision camera, which will display a rear view on the screen. And the 303A package not only has this, but also has forward facing sensors (which I believe are only active at very slow speeds--otherwise, they'd always be beeping). My car's not here yet, so this is based on the web site & user manual. In another 9 days hope to confirm at least the 302A information!
